using System;
using System.Data;
using System.Text;
using System.Collections;
using System.Collections.Generic;
using System.IO;
using System.Threading;
using Mono.Data.SqliteClient;
namespace UnitySQL {
public static class SQLite {
private static string _uri = "URI=file:SQLite.db";
private static string _dbName = "SQLite";
private static IDbConnection _dbcon;
public static void SetURI(string value) {
_uri = value;
_dbName = null;
}
public static string GetURI() {
return _uri;
}
public static void SetDbName(string value) {
_uri = "URI=file:" + value + ".db";
_dbName = value;
}
public static string GetDbName() {
return _dbName;
}
//Sets up the database
public static void Setup() {
_dbcon = (IDbConnection) new SqliteConnection(_uri);
_dbcon.Open();
}
public static int Count(string table, string column) {
string sql = string.Format("SELECT COUNT(`{0}`) c FROM {1}", column, table);
IDataReader reader = QueryAsReader(sql);
reader.Read();
int count = reader.GetInt32(0);
return count;
}
public static void Query(string query, Dictionary<string, string> parameters = null, bool threaded = true) {
if (threaded == true) {
Thread sqlThread = new Thread(() => Query(query, parameters));
sqlThread.Start();
} else {
IDbCommand cmd = _dbcon.CreateCommand();
cmd.CommandText = query;
if (parameters != null) {
foreach(KeyValuePair<string, string> param in parameters) {
cmd.Parameters.Add(new SqliteParameter(param.Key, param.Value));
}
}
IDataReader reader = cmd.ExecuteReader();
reader.Close();
}
}
public static IDataReader QueryAsReader(string query, Dictionary<string, string> parameters = null) {
IDbCommand cmd = _dbcon.CreateCommand();
cmd.CommandText = query;
if (parameters != null) {
foreach(KeyValuePair<string, string> param in parameters) {
cmd.Parameters.Add(new SqliteParameter(param.Key, param.Value));
}
}
return cmd.ExecuteReader();
}
public static List<Dictionary<string, string>> QueryAsList(string query, Dictionary<string, string> parameters = null) {
List<Dictionary<string, string>> list = new List<Dictionary<string, string>>();
IDataReader reader = QueryAsReader(query, parameters);
while(reader.Read()) {
Dictionary<string, string> record = new Dictionary<string, string>();
for ( int i = 0; i < reader.FieldCount; i++) {
record.Add(reader.GetName(i), (string) reader.GetValue(i));
}
list.Add(record);
}
reader.Close();
return list;
}
private static string ReadFile(string path) {
StreamReader sr = new StreamReader(path);
string contents;
try {
contents = sr.ReadToEnd();
}
catch(System.IO.IOException exception) {
return null;
}
return contents;
}
public static void RunFile(string path, Dictionary<string, string> parameters = null, bool threaded = true) {
string query = ReadFile(path);
Query(query, parameters, threaded);
}
public static IDataReader RunFileAsReader(string path, Dictionary<string, string> parameters = null) {
string query = ReadFile(path);
return QueryAsReader(query, parameters);
}
public static List<Dictionary<string, string>> RunFileAsList(string path, Dictionary<string, string> parameters = null) {
string query = ReadFile(path);
return QueryAsList(query, parameters);
}
public static void Insert(string table, List<Dictionary<string, object>> data) {
StringBuilder sql = new StringBuilder();
sql.Append("INSERT INTO `" + table + "` (");
if(data.Count == 0) {
return;
}
int index = 0;
foreach(KeyValuePair<string, object> pair in data[0]) {
sql.Append(" `");
sql.Append(pair.Key);
sql.Append("`");
if (index < (data[0].Count - 1)) {
sql.Append(",");
}
index++;
}
sql.Append(")\n");
sql.Append("VALUES");
index = 0;
foreach(Dictionary<string, object> row in data) {
index++;
sql.Append("(");
int index2 = 0;
foreach(KeyValuePair<string, object> pair in row) {
sql.Append(" '");
sql.Append(pair.Value);
sql.Append("'");
if(index2 < (row.Count - 1)) {
sql.Append(",");
}
index2++;
}
sql.Append(")");
if (index < (data.Count - 1)) {
sql.Append(",\n");
}
index++;
}
Query(sql.ToString());
}
public static void Insert(string table, Dictionary<string, object> data) {
List<Dictionary<string, object>> dataList = new List<Dictionary<string, object>>();
dataList.Add(data);
Insert(table, dataList);
}
}
}
